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Over-bleaching: Excessive bleaching can damage the hair, leading to dryness, breakage, and split ends.
- Insufficient toner: Failing to use enough toner can result in brassiness or unwanted warm undertones.
- Improper application: Applying the hair color incorrectly can lead to unevenness, streaks, or discoloration.
- Overlapping: Applying hair color too often can weigh the hair down and make it appear dull.
- Using harsh products: Shampoos, conditioners, and styling products with harsh chemicals can strip the hair of its natural oils and damage its color.

FAQs
-
Can I dye my hair light ash brown at home?
– It’s possible but not recommended for inexperienced individuals. Professional hair colorists have the expertise and tools to achieve optimal results with minimal damage. -
How long does hair light ash brown last?
– The longevity of the color depends on factors such as the starting color, hair porosity, and home hair care routine. With proper care, it can last several months. -
What is the best hair care routine for light ash brown hair?
– Use color-safe shampoos and conditioners, avoid over-washing, deep condition regularly, and protect the hair from heat and UV exposure. -
Can I use a toner to enhance the color of my hair light ash brown?
– Yes, toners can be used to adjust the undertones, neutralize brassiness, and achieve a more desired shade. -
How often should I get touch-ups?
– The frequency of touch-ups depends on the individual’s hair growth rate and desired level of vibrancy. Generally, it’s recommended to get a touch-up every 6-8 weeks. -
Is hair light ash brown suitable for all hair types?
– It’s generally suitable for healthy hair types. However, it may not be suitable for very fine or heavily damaged hair.
